دوره ماکرو نویسی در کتیا 

محتوی و هدف دوره ماکرونویسی :

زمانی که طراح به مدل سازی طرح خود با نرم افزار کتیا میپردازد ، عملا اطلاعات خود یا دیگران را در طراحی اعمال میکند. امروزه استفاده بهینه و قابلیت پردازش این اطلاعات برای صنعتگران بسیارمهم می باشد. این امر جایگاه ویژه ای را به قابلیت طراحی پارامتریک در نرم افزار های طراحی بخشیده است. طراحی پارامتریک و بهینه سازی نقش اساسی را در طراحی مهندسی ایفا می کند. شاید مهمترین مسئله ای که در این مقوله یادآوری می شود بحث کمترین وزن ممکن است، چرا که وزن کم در بسیاری از طراحی ها موجب صرفه جویی در اقتصاد انرژی است، اما بهینه سازی نه تنها در مقولۀ وزن کاربرد دارد بلکه در تمام زمینه ها مانند حجم، زمان، نیرو، و… مطرح است. خوشبختانه نرم افزار CATA این قابلیت را دارد تا با خاصیت یکپارچگی خود و ارتباط بین محیط های مختلف اکثر بهینه سازه های لازم در مهندسی را به طور دقیق با استفاده از الگوریتم های قوی و استاندارد  مانند الگوریتم ژنتیک انجام دهد.

کاربردهای طراحی پارامتریک : 

  1. استفاده گسترده در علوم مهندسی مانند استاتیک ، دینامیک ، مقاومت مصالح ، طراحی اجزا 
  2. انعطاف پذیری بالای طراحی ها و قابل فهم تر بودن آن ها 
  3. ساختقطعات و مجموعه های هوشمند
  4. جلوگیری از اشتباهات ناخواسته و صرفه جویی در زمان

مخاطبین دوره :

دانشجویان و مهندسان مکانیک ، مواد و  طراحی صنعتی

صنعتگران ، طراحان صنعتی

علاقه مندان به طراحی

ماکرونویسی در کتیا چیست؟

چرا باید ماکرونویسی در کنیا رو آموزش ببینم؟

فواید یادگیری ماکرونویسی در کتیا

توضیحی مختصر درمورد ماکرونویسی درکتیا توسط مدرس دوره↓↓

ماکرونویسی در CATIA : این دوره در دوره ۴۰ و ۶۰ ساعتی برگزار میشود که مخاطب با توجه به نیاز خود و سر فصل ها ، در دوره شرکت میکند .

این دوره در مدت ۴۰ ساعت برگزار میشود 

سرفصل آموزش ماکرونویسی در CATIA  

ردیفعنوانتوضیحات
۱آموزش مفاهیم زبان برنامه نویسیسطح بندی زبانها ، شی گرایی ،الگریتم نویسی ، رویدادگرایی ، ماژول نویسی و …
۲پروژه : تبدیل واحدهای مهندسیآموزش المانهای گرافیکی ، دستورات برنامه نویسی و …
۳شروع مقدمات ماکرونویسی ومفاهیم ساختاری

CATIA

تعاریف مقدماتی ، انواع زبانها ، نحوه ضبط و ویرایش و ذخیره سازی ماکرو ، معرفی درخت ساختار نرم افزار و…
۴برنامه نویسی در محیط sketcherتعریف و کنترل دستورات دو بعدی در برنامه نویسی
۵پروژه : طراحی ابزاری جهت ترسیم چند ضلعی با تعداد اضلاع دلخواه در نقطه دلخواهتحلیل کدهای به دست آمده و کد نویسی بدون ضبط ماکرو در محیط sketcher
۶برنامه نویسی در محیط partتعریف و کنترل نمایه ها ، پارامترها ، طراحی پارامتریک و…
۷پروژه : طراحی قطعات استانداردآموزش کار با پارامترها و فعال و غیر فعال سازی نمایه ها
۸برنامه نویسی درمحیطAssemblyمفاهیم محیط مونتاژ ، ابزارهای جابجایی ، فرمول نویسی ، خواندن درخت طراحی ،ساخت و ایجاد پارامتر برای هر عضو درخت
۹پروژه : طراحی ابزاری جهت خواندن درخت طراحی و پنهان و پیدا کردن زیر مجموعه های خاصآموزش استخراج پارامترها از درخت طراحی و …
۱۰برنامه نویسی در محیطDraftingایجاد انواع نماها و ترسیمات دوبعدی ، ایجاد text و اقسام آن، تهیه جدول و…
۱۱پروژه : ایجاد صفحه و جدول نقشهکار با المانهای دوبعدی و تعریف موقعیت ها در نقشه و…
۱۲برنامه نویسی در DataBaseفراخوانی EXCEL ، بستن و باز کردن فایل ، ذخیره و ایجاد صفحات جدید ، خواندن و نوشتن روی سلول ها و…
۱۳پروژه : طراحی ابزاری جهت استخراج ویژگی های درخت طراحی در EXCELتمرین مفاهیم قبلی و ایجاد ارتباط بین EXCEL و CATIA

این دوره در مدت ۶۰ ساعت برگزار میشود 

سرفصل آموزش ماکرونویسی در CATIA

ردیف

عنوان

مدت

۱آشنایی با محیط های KnowledgeWare شامل KnowlegeAdviser,Knowledge Expert و ,Product Knowledge Template۲
۲شناخت پارامترها و روابط در CATIA و اتصال بین جدول EXCEL و پارامترهای CATIA با حل یک مثال(طراحی چرخدنده)۲
۳درک مفهوم PUBLICATION با حل چند نمونه مثال۳
۴شناخت و استفاده از دستور POWER COPY  و USER FEATURE برای پرهیز از انجام فعالیتهای تکراری در CATIA۴
۵استفاده از RULE برای اعمال شرایط خاص در MODEL۲
۶آشنایی با زبان برنامه نویسی CATIA۴
۷آموزش زبان برنامه نویسی ویژوال بیسیک برای نوشتن ماکرو در CATIA شامل جملات شرطی ،حلقه ها و USER FORM ها۸
۸نحوه نوشتن برنامه در محیط های SKETCH ,PART DESIGN و ASSEMBLY DESIGN۱۵
۹گرفتن پارت لیست از CATIA با سربرگ دلخواه۵
۱۰نوشتن اسکریپت با استفاده از زبان برنامه نویسی ویژوال بیسیک و اتصال آن به RULE۵
۱۱پروژه پایانی(طراحی قالب کشش به صورت پارامتریک و کدنویسی)۱۰
۱۲

جمع ساعات           ۶۰

ماکرو چیست؟
چرا باید ماکرونویس را یاد بگیریم؟فواید ماکرو نویسی در کتیا چیست؟
توضیحاتی کوتاه درمورد آموزش ماکرونویسی درکتیا همراه با استاد حاج صادقیان

کتیا پیشرفته

برای اشنایی بیشتر با این دوره

میتوانید این ویدئو را تماشا کنید..

دوره ماکرونویسی در کتیا

مرکز طراحی و مهندسی معکوس ایلیا

https://www.aparat.com/v/MvJNp